{-# LANGUAGE DeriveGeneric #-} {-# LANGUAGE DuplicateRecordFields #-} {-# LANGUAGE NamedFieldPuns #-} {-# LANGUAGE OverloadedStrings #-} {-# LANGUAGE RecordWildCards #-} {-# LANGUAGE StrictData #-} {-# LANGUAGE TypeFamilies #-} {-# LANGUAGE NoImplicitPrelude #-} {-# OPTIONS_GHC -fno-warn-unused-binds #-} {-# OPTIONS_GHC -fno-warn-unused-imports #-} {-# OPTIONS_GHC -fno-warn-unused-matches #-} -- Derived from AWS service descriptions, licensed under Apache 2.0. -- | -- Module : Amazonka.CloudWatch.PutMetricStream -- Copyright : (c) 2013-2023 Brendan Hay -- License : Mozilla Public License, v. 2.0. -- Maintainer : Brendan Hay -- Stability : auto-generated -- Portability : non-portable (GHC extensions) -- -- Creates or updates a metric stream. Metric streams can automatically -- stream CloudWatch metrics to Amazon Web Services destinations, including -- Amazon S3, and to many third-party solutions. -- -- For more information, see -- . -- -- To create a metric stream, you must be signed in to an account that has -- the @iam:PassRole@ permission and either the @CloudWatchFullAccess@ -- policy or the @cloudwatch:PutMetricStream@ permission. -- -- When you create or update a metric stream, you choose one of the -- following: -- -- - Stream metrics from all metric namespaces in the account. -- -- - Stream metrics from all metric namespaces in the account, except for -- the namespaces that you list in @ExcludeFilters@. -- -- - Stream metrics from only the metric namespaces that you list in -- @IncludeFilters@. -- -- By default, a metric stream always sends the @MAX@, @MIN@, @SUM@, and -- @SAMPLECOUNT@ statistics for each metric that is streamed. You can use -- the @StatisticsConfigurations@ parameter to have the metric stream send -- additional statistics in the stream. Streaming additional statistics -- incurs additional costs. For more information, see -- . -- -- When you use @PutMetricStream@ to create a new metric stream, the stream -- is created in the @running@ state.
